Ingredients You’ll Need:

  • 2 tablespoons unsalted butter
  • 1 medium onion, finely chopped
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 cup heavy cream
  • 1/2 cup chicken or vegetable broth
  • 1 c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• 1/2 cup grated mozzarella cheese
  • 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1/4 teaspoon paprika
  • Salt and pepper, to taste
  • 1 lb pasta (fettuccine, penne, or your favorite type)
  • 1/2 cup cooked chicken or shrimp (optional, for added protein)
  • Fresh parsley, chopped (optional, for garnish)
